So much for the Dallas Cowboys offense’s difficulties. Prescott, Dak and his team eventually exploded after a friendly wager between the Dallas defense and offense.
The Cowboys dominated the Washington Football Team 56-14 on Sunday Night Football, including a staggering 42-point first half.
Prescott was nasty with reporters after the game when they inquired about the offense’s recent downturn, and the Cowboys star wasn’t having it.
After a difficult series of games, the Cowboys offense grabbed the spotlight.
In the first half, Cowboys quarterback Dak Prescott is 27-of-35 for 320 yards and four touchdowns.

For almost everyone in a Dallas jersey, the first half was electrifying. Prescott passed for 320 yards and four touchdowns. Ezekiel Elliott scored two touchdowns, Amari Cooper and Dalton Schultz both received touchdown passes, and offensive guard Terence Steele also scored.
All of this happened in the first half, thanks to DeMarcus Lawrence’s pick-six against Taylor Heinicke.
After scoring just five offensive touchdowns in the previous three games, the performance against Washington on Sunday was much-needed.
Prescott had four touchdowns, Elliott had two, and Malik Turner scored on a Cooper Rush touchdown throw as the Cowboys cruised to win.

Despite the fact that Prescott’s and the offense’s previous weeks didn’t go as planned, Week 16 went off without a hitch. Despite a 42-point win against a divisional opponent, the offense scored six total touchdowns, which is more than they had scored in the previous three games.
What could possibly be better?
Prescott, on the other hand, wasn’t pleased with the Cowboys’ recent struggles and made an arrogant comment (h/t Charean Williams of Pro Football Talk).
“You’re telling me?” I never said that we were in a rut. That was your exact phrase. I believe it would be difficult for you to say that today.”

To be honest, it’s difficult to say that today. Except for CeeDee Lamb, who had four receptions for 66 yards on the evening, everyone got involved.
Oh, and remember Cooper’s remarks about wanting to be more engaged from earlier in the week? On a team-high 11 targets, he had seven receptions for 85 yards and a touchdown.
The Cowboys are back, and if things go their way, they might nab the NFC’s top seed.
With two games left in the regular season, the Cowboys move to 11-4 and hold the No. 2 seed in the NFC playoffs.

The Cowboys won the NFC East and are now the second seed in the NFC, behind the Green Bay Packers, after beating Washington.
The Arizona Cardinals were defeated by the Indianapolis Colts on Christmas Day, while the Tampa Bay Buccaneers and Los Angeles Rams are both 11-4 following Sunday’s victory.
For the time being, the Cowboys are ranked second, and they play the Cardinals and the Philadelphia Eagles in Week 18, which might be a win-and-in situation for the Eagles.
Nonetheless, the Cowboys’ offensive woes have gotten a lot of attention in the last month, and properly so. Prescott and the bunch seem to be back, and what a time to put up a 56-point effort.
